    Tourism real estate refers to a kind of tourism function which is achieved or partly achieved to develop the real estate and the marketing model. Tourism real estate which has had a significant impact on Chinese tourism and the development of real estate has experienced a rapid development since it was brought into China. Chengdu, which is famous for the "leisure capital", is the capital city of Sichuan province. To develop tourism real estate has its own characteristics compared with other regions. Tourism real estate stretches across the tourism industry and the real estate, having a strong correlation with many other industries. Therefore, tourism real estate is significant to the development of Chengdu. As to Chengdu, the tourism and real estate have become new economic growth points, and the combination of tourism and real estate also shows a good tendency, and a number of development projects have walked in the forefront of the country. However, there have also many problems. Some of those projects have created some negative impact both on the economy and the environment, and these issues need to be analyzed and measured. This paper analyzes the necessity and feasibility to develop the tourism real estate in Chengdu, and pertinently puts forward some recommendations.
